Output 8bd943c598787b8409f6acfd3b07111ffff8620481da7e1bd855ed765bd92825:2

value
26158902
script pubkey
OP_0 OP_PUSHBYTES_32 84e88e2669d44c4e794989849c65582031ad15415db94201df7b7d50b1f6207e
address
bc1qsn5gufnf63xyu72f3xzfce2cyqc6692ptku5yqwl0d74pv0kyplqjdcktp
transaction
8bd943c598787b8409f6acfd3b07111ffff8620481da7e1bd855ed765bd92825